Q3 Planning Note — Sales Leads Only

The divestiture of the Larkspur Analytics unit to Venmore Holdings is proceeding on schedule, with diligence expected to close by mid-quarter. Please review your pipelines carefully and flag any accounts with Larkspur dependencies before reassignment. Forecast adjustments are due Friday. The note below outlines the rationale and next steps.

confidential, hadup-yaguf: Briielox Systems plans to raise the Holax list price by 5 percent in July.

## Build Provenance — Memtrawl

Hey on-call: every Memtrawl release (our GPU memory profiler) is built on the Quillfarm runners and signed before it ships. If someone pages you about a sketchy binary, don't guess — check provenance first. Grab the artifact, run `memtrawl verify`, and compare against the ledger on the Pellwick wiki. Most false alarms are just stale caches on the Orbeck fleet. The current canonical build token is listed below.

session token of tajog-fahaf = htk21_4ae55819f45410afcb307

Subject: Cut-over summary — Deploybeak chat bot

Hi, as requested for your review: we completed the cut-over of Deploybeak, the bot that posts deploy status into team channels, on Tuesday night. The old polling bridge is disabled, webhook signatures are verified on every inbound event, and scopes were reduced to read-only. The bot now runs with the following configuration.

deployment values, kajep-kageg:
[praix]
host = praix.paliqcorp.corp
user = praix_svc
database = praix_prod